Diversity in Dietetics Education

CADE supports the belief that ADA’s mission and vision are most effectively realized through a diverse membership.  As in all health professions, diversity is necessary for access to and the quality of services for the public.  To increase diversity in educational programs, ADA developed a tool kit for dietetics educators and practitioners to use in mentoring diverse students for dietetics careers.  The toolkit can be used to establish:

  • community-based mentoring programs for K-8 and high school students that will raise awareness of dietetics careers and increase the pool of potential students from underrepresented groups, and
  • college and university-based mentoring programs that will attract and retain students from diverse cultures in dietetics education programs.
